Why Electrolux Dryer Heating Coil is Necessary

From my experience, the heating coil is one of the most important parts of an Electrolux dryer because it is what creates the heat needed to dry clothes properly. Without it, my dryer would only tumble wet clothes around without removing moisture, which means laundry would take much longer or stay damp. The heating coil makes the whole drying process efficient and reliable.

I also find that a properly working heating coil helps my dryer perform consistently. When the coil is in good condition, my clothes dry evenly, and I do not have to run extra cycles. That saves me time, energy, and money on electricity. It also helps reduce wear on my clothes, since I am not over-drying them just to get them fully dry.

Another reason I value the heating coil is that it supports the overall health of my dryer. If the coil is damaged or failing, the dryer may overheat, dry poorly, or stop working altogether. Keeping this part in good shape helps my appliance last longer and keeps my laundry routine smooth and dependable.

How I Checked Compatibility First

The first thing I did was confirm the exact model number of my Electrolux dryer. I learned that even within the same brand, heating coils can vary by model and series. I always compared the part number from my dryer manual or old coil with the replacement listing. In my experience, this step saved me from ordering the wrong part.

What I Checked Before Buying Online

Before placing an order, I always reviewed the product description carefully. I looked for:

  • Exact Electrolux model compatibility
  • Part number matching
  • Voltage and wattage details
  • Included hardware or installation notes
  • Return policy and warranty coverage

This helped me avoid surprises when the part arrived.

Installation Considerations I Kept in Mind

I always thought about installation before buying. Some heating coils are simple enough for a confident DIY repair, while others may require more careful handling. I made sure I had the right tools and understood the safety steps, especially disconnecting power before starting. If I felt uncertain, I would rather choose a part that came with clear instructions or get professional help.
